Transponder Chip Keys
Transponder chips can be found inside the head of the majority of newer keys for cars. This security feature can help prevent theft of the vehicle, since the vehicle cannot be started without the correct key. The transponder is a microprocessor which transmits codes to the immobilizer system of the vehicle when the key is inserted into the ignition.
This allows the vehicle to start and blocks any unauthorized access to the engine. It also eliminates traditional hotwiring techniques and acts as a an effective deterrent for thieves.
The most common Vauxhall key is referred to as a "transponder" or "chip key". It's a flat metal key with an embedded microprocessor which sends a message to the car immobilizer when it's placed in the ignition. Transponder chips are designed to be a permanent component of the key, so they will not be able to fail, however they do have a life span and can malfunction.
Sometimes, the chip fails to function due to physical damage, such as cracks in the shell or worn-out contacts. In other instances, the issue may be caused by a programming error or compatibility problem between the key and the car's immobilizer system. Remote Keys
The Vauxhall remote key is comparable
how to Change vauxhall key fob any other car key however, it has an electronic chip that disables the immobiliser system in your vehicle. The keys also have a button to unlock doors and start your engine. To function, these keys require that your vehicle be located within a certain distance of the ignition. The immobiliser is triggered by the proximity sensor in your car, making it possible to drive without having to physically turn the ignition key.
